                   Image 19. Conservation Statutes categories established for the IUCN Red List. In order to establish
                   a  conservation  statue,  it  is  necessary  to  have  adequate  data  about  specie  abundance  and
                   distribution. Therefore, not all species are evaluated or have all the necessary data to establish a
                   conservation statue. Extinction probability increases from Least Concern to the right (bottom).
